I keep a logbook like that in all my vehicles. It's no trouble at all, and I find it's very helpful when I need reminders as to what kind of maintenance may be due. Years and miles pass a lot quicker than you think they do when some maintenance items/ projects become due. It's helpful to track mileage and I always try to do a tune-up before the smog check comes due also.
